How often, when and who suffers most of all from sclerosis?
Multiple sclerosis is the third frequent disease (exceeded only by twing disease and epilepsy) in neurology. In USA, this disease affects millions of people. The guile of multiple sclerosis is that the bulk of cases occur in the younger generation.
Moreover, in women sclerosis occurs twice more than in men. Before 15 and after 60 years the multiple sclerosis may begin in rather rare cases. People living in northern latitudes, where there is little solar energy, more prone to this suffering, as those who leave in equator. Representatives of the European races are sick more often than the black and Asian races. And also, there is a great role of hereditary factors – if one of the parents is sick, the risk of multiple sclerosis in the child significantly increases.
